George I burr walnut bureau bookcase ( England c. 1725 )

Medium

Burr walnut

Dimensions:

30.00inch wide (76.20 cm)
75.00inch high (190.50 cm)
20.50inch deep (52.07 cm)

Description / Expertise

A superb George I burr walnut & feather banded bureau bookcase of compact proportions and retaining excellent colour and patina.

The top section with an internal arrangement of adjustable shelves with concave moulding out-stepped at each corner to form pillars which border an opening single door with a bevelled mirror plate and single candle slide beneath.

The fall of the bureau section opens to reveal a central cupboard and an arrangement of pigeon holes and drawers, with a leather lined writing surface. The fall is supported by a pair of retractable lopers which are separated by two short feather-banded, oak lined drawers fitted with oval escutcheons and brass ring pull handles, below a further three long graduated drawers. The bookcase is supported on burr walnut bracket feet. A truly superb quality piece, with choice use of quality burr veneers throughout its construction.

Provenance

The collection of the late Francis Egerton, supplied by Mallets, Bond Street.

Literature

English, George I, circa 1725

Condition

Excellent. Minor restorations to chipped veneers, waxing, later mirror plate, brassware believed to be original.
